Output ddc0c743dfce8ade52b280fa8aba742bed4e6ffcd698d2a0b36e8a072369e356:0

value
158604475
script pubkey
OP_0 OP_PUSHBYTES_20 fb8e8e5664158109801b195b15763d7cc0c50d55
address
bc1qlw8gu4nyzkqsnqqmr9d32a3a0nqv2r24sauu7k
transaction
ddc0c743dfce8ade52b280fa8aba742bed4e6ffcd698d2a0b36e8a072369e356
confirmations
153086
spent
true